Overcoming Barriers to Effective Teamwork in Healthcare

In order to overcome the barriers to effective teamwork in healthcare, it is essential to address the issue of professional hierarchies. In many healthcare settings, there is a clear hierarchy in place, with doctors and specialists often holding a position of power over other members of the team. This can hinder effective communication and collaboration, as other team members may feel reluctant to speak up or provide input due to a fear of being dismissed or disrespected by those in higher positions. It is crucial for healthcare organizations to promote a culture of equality and respect, where every team member's input is valued and encouraged, regardless of their role or title.

Another significant barrier to effective teamwork in healthcare is a lack of clear and open communication. In a fast-paced and high-pressure environment like a hospital or clinic, miscommunication can easily occur, leading to errors, delays, and negative patient outcomes. It is essential for healthcare professionals to prioritize clear and concise communication, ensuring that important information is shared in a timely manner and understood by all team members. This can be achieved through regular team meetings, the use of standardized communication tools and protocols, and fostering a supportive and open environment where questions and clarifications are welcomed and encouraged.
